Wanted to do a nightvideo so i soldered together 6 10mm white leds and powered them with a 11.1v lipo. Decent light atleast and was fun to do some driving and actually see something

The lights doesnt look so great but they do their job.

Man you realy need to get the short baral spring it will help alot. I know it made a huge diff on my truck after watching your vid I think you will love the diff it makes . The truck is much harder to tip with the short barals And the incline crawl about dubles befor it trys to tork twist .
